Rangers are reportedly set to lose 18-year-old striker talent Nathan Young-Coombes to Brentford as his contract enters its final six months.

The Ibrox kid has been with the club for the last two years having joined Rangers following spells with Chelsea and Crystal Palace down south.

Now, the England youth international is reportedly set to return south of the border with a move to ambitious Championship outfit Brentford.

That’s according to Football Transfers with journalist Robin Bairner claiming an exclusive over the move.

Bairner claims that the Bees have “won the race” to sign the forward with Young-Coombes set to move to the Brentford Community Stadium this month.

A talented young player and amongst the brightest talents at the club, losing out on Young-Coombes will come as a small blow to fans.

Rangers fans thought they’d lost Young-Coombes in the summer when he was rumoured to be heading to West Ham [Four Lads].

However, the striker has stayed put but won’t be for much longer as a report claims Rangers are set to lose the player to Brentford.

There are two Championship players set to come the opposite way however with the Gers striking pre-contract deals with two Bournemouth players this month.

Rangers have already announced the pre-contract signing of defender Jack Simpson with manager Jason Tindall claiming Nmandi Ofoborh won’t be far behind.
